Output d7af32cf9162542798836f22f432398b31296e72d20286b89f304dbb4996261e:0

value
20650
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d957ba9d70a038e79e31c0f2d313d0d51708d7ba6640e2f991ef6a2936b314e
address
bc1pmk2hh2whpgpcu70rrs8j6vfap4ghprtm5ejqutuermm29ymtx98qw7uv70
transaction
d7af32cf9162542798836f22f432398b31296e72d20286b89f304dbb4996261e
spent
true